Corero Network Security Officially Enters Southeast Asia Market
Today marks an exciting development for Corero Network Security (AIM: CNS) (OTCQX: DDOSF), a leading provider in DDoS protection and adaptive service availability. In partnership with ONESECURE Asia Pte Ltd, Corero takes its first significant step into the Southeast Asian market, providing innovative solutions tailored to local needs.
Strategic Partnership for Enhanced Security Solutions
This partnership advances Corero's growth strategy in the Asia-Pacific (APAC) region. By combining its cutting-edge, automated resiliency solutions with ONESECURE's regional expertise, the collaboration aims to deliver stronger cybersecurity measures. Together, they will enhance the protection for telecom operators, enterprises, and service providers facing increasing digital threats.

ONESECURE Asia Pte Ltd's Role in Cyber Defense
ONESECURE Asia, based in Singapore and a subsidiary of Secura Group Ltd, excels in DDoS mitigation for telecom sectors. Their experience managing complex network threats makes them a valuable partner in local cybersecurity implementation. About Corero Network Security
Corero Network Security stands at the forefront of DDoS protection solutions. Specializing in automated detection and response systems, their technologies assure service availability against external and internal threats. With centers of operation in Marlborough, Massachusetts, and Edinburgh, UK, Corero is committed to ensuring internet service integrity across diverse environments.
